Vaileka, commonly known as Rakiraki Town, is an urban centre in Fiji, in the Rakiraki region of Ra Province. It had a population of 3,361 at the 1996 census, the last to date. Vaileka is situated 6 km southwest of Rarapatu Mandir Polling Venue.
